Transaction 59628c28f83fb0cc933ba59325895dd20d009768fe869cbf2d8ad2641664b904
1 Input
1 Output
-
59628c28f83fb0cc933ba59325895dd20d009768fe869cbf2d8ad2641664b904:0
- value
- 5046
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4909601570842c25ac62d2132d56bb6028ce6def696d354f1d89aa15228d937b
- address
- bc1pfyykq9tssskzttrz6gfj644mvq5vum00d9kn2nca3x4p2g5djdasd6vslr